Monoclonal Antibody Purification: A Two-Step Approach Using A Strong AEX-HIC Mixed-Mode Resin

The rising focus on monoclonal antibodies (mAbs) in the biopharma pipeline has intensified the need for more efficient and cost-effective purification processes. Traditionally, achieving high product purity and effective viral clearance requires three distinct chromatography steps following the initial protein A capture. However, this multi-step approach introduces complexity, increases material consumption, and drives up overall production costs.

In this webinar, you will learn about an alternative process that streamlines downstream processing. By optimizing a single mixed-mode chromatography step, it is possible to eliminate an entire purification step, enabling a robust two-step strategy after protein A capture. This innovative workflow significantly cuts down on media and buffer costs, reduces processing time, and enhances the overall efficiency of your mAb production.
